The Department of Human Services operates a panel of print management providers, as part of a wider cooperative procurement program relating to the development, production and / or distribution of communication products and materials.
The current panel (standing offer SON2658382) commenced on 30 October 2014 and expires on 29 October 2019.
The Department of Human Services is releasing a tender to refresh the panel. The new panel will commence on 30 October 2019.
The panel in its current form, and with its current membership, will expire on 29 October 2019. Members of the current panel must respond to the tender in full if they wish to be a panel member from 30 October 2019.
The arrangements will allow for all Australian Government agencies, as well as state and territory government agencies, to access the panel.
This cooperative procurement program does not represent a whole of government arrangement, and is not part of the coordinated procurement framework administered by the Department of Finance.
Services available under the current panel include:
Print consultancy and brokerage
In-house design
Print procurement and job management
Digital asset management and version control
Supplier relationship management
Inventory management
Consolidated invoicing and reporting.
